‘Sham Impeachment:’ Texas GOP, Trump Allies Blast Attempt to Impeach AG Ken Paxton

May 27, 2023No Comments6 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

The speaker of the Texas state legislature, Rep. Dade Phelan (R), is leading an effort to impeach Attorney General Ken Paxton, a Donald Trump ally and one of the most staunch foes of Big Tech censorship.

Nominally a Republican, Rep. Phelan has appointed over a dozen Democrats to chair committees in the Texas legislature, despite the GOP holding a supermajority in the chamber.

Phelan is a state representative for Texas’ 21st district, which covers most of Jefferson and all of Orange and Jasper counties in the southeast corner of the state.

Former president Donald Trump has called out Phelan in the past on a number of issues. Calling the speaker “another Mitch McConnell,” Trump has called out the Texas politician for siding with Democrats to reduce penalties for illegal voting.

Now Phelan is going after Ken Paxton, one of Trump’s biggest allies in the Lone Star State, leading to condemnation from the Texas GOP.

The statement, signed by Republican Party of Texas chairman Matt Rinaldi, slammed the speaker for his friendliness to Democrats and his relitigating of old allegations against Paxton — allegations that even the Biden Administration’s Department of Justice has yet to bring charges over.

“Speaker Dade Phelan and his leadership team have appointed Democrats to high ranking leadership positions, attacked the Republican Party of Texas, battled our  conservative Lieutenant Governor, and killed Governor Abbott’s top priorities,” wrote Rinaldi.

As attorney general, Paxton has proven one of the most effective foes of Big Tech censorship. He is leading one of the largest multi-state antitrust lawsuits against Google over its ad dominance, as well as a lawsuit against the same tech company over biometric data collection.

Paxton also recently launched an inquiry into the pharmaceutical companies Pfizer, Johnson & Johnson, and Moderna, investigating allegations that the companies misrepresented the safety and efficacy of their coronavirus vaccines.

In his campaign against the attorney general, Phelan and his allies in the Texas sate legislature is alleging a long list of prior improprieties, including bribery allegations. But these allegations were widely broadcast to voters ahead of the 2022 elections for attorney general, which Paxton comfortably won.
